蘑菇形右心室流出道动脉瘤可能为小儿致心律失常性右心室心肌病提供早期线索。

Mushroom-Shaped Right Ventricular Outflow Tract Aneurysm May Provide an Early Clue in Pediatric Arrhythmogenic Right Ventricular Cardiomyopathy.

Abstract

• ARVC is a life-threatening disease that requires early detection to prevent SCD. • ms-RVOT may serve as an early clue for diagnosis of ARVC. • ms-RVOT may help preempt adverse outcomes in asymptomatic ARVC cases.
